Course Overview

This course provides managers with essential tools to make informed financial decisions and drive organisational performance. It covers financial statement interpretation, key accounting principles, risk-return analysis, and working capital optimization. Participants will also gain practical skills in budgeting, cost control, investment appraisal, and long-term planning, while learning how to align financial strategies with stakeholder expectations through integrated reporting.

Agenda

Day—1 Strategic Financial Management Foundations

  • Interpreting financial statements for managerial decisions
  • Key accounting concepts and regulatory frameworks
  • Measuring risk and return in managerial investment decisions

Day—2 Budgeting, Cash Flow, and Cost Control

  • Cash flow analysis and working capital optimization
  • Advanced budgeting techniques and variance analysis
  • Cost behaviour, strategic cost management, and break-even tools

Day—3 Investment Analysis and Stakeholder Financial Strategy

  • Capital budgeting and investment appraisal methods
  • Long-term financial planning and project estimation
  • Stakeholder accountability and integrated (triple bottom line) reporting
